  4. Sep 8, 2021 · The Kamchatka Peninsula is a peninsula in northeastern Asia jutting from Russian Far East. It lies between the Bering Sea and the Pacific Ocean, and the Sea of Okhotsk, covering approximately 270,000 square kilometers. The peninsula is almost the size of New Zealand and slightly larger than the United Kingdom. It is part of the Kamchatka Krai.

  5. Kamchatka, kray (territory), far eastern Russia. The territory was created in 2007 when the Kamchatka oblast (region) was merged with the Koryak autonomous okrug (district). The territory includes the entire Kamchatka Peninsula and the southern end of the Koryak Mountains.
